Bahrain has rapidly positioned itself as one of the most business-friendly destinations in the Middle East. In 2026, international entrepreneurs are increasingly choosing Bahrain for its progressive regulations, cost-effective setup options, and 100% foreign ownership policies. Unlike many GCC countries, Bahrain eliminates the need for a local sponsor in most sectors making it a strategic entry point for global founders.
Another major advantage is the rise of virtual office solutions, allowing entrepreneurs to establish a legal business presence without maintaining a physical office. This flexibility significantly reduces overhead costs while maintaining full compliance with regulatory authorities. The investment required depends on the business structure and activity:
| Business Type | Minimum Investment |
|---|---|
| SPC (Single Person Company) | BHD 50 β BHD 1,000 |
| WLL (With Limited Liability) | BHD 1,000+ |
| Branch Office | No fixed minimum |
| Virtual Office Setup | Lower than physical office |
Bahrain remains one of the most affordable jurisdictions in the GCC for business formation.

| Expense Category | Estimated Cost (BHD) |
|---|---|
| Company Registration | 100 β 300 |
| Virtual Office | 200 β 600/year |
| License Fees | 50 β 200 |
| Visa Fees | 300 β 700 |
| Bank Setup | Varies |
Overall, Bahrain business setup for international entrepreneurs remains highly cost-efficient compared to other GCC countries.

1. Can foreigners own 100% of a business in Bahrain?
Yes, most sectors allow full foreign ownership.
2. Is a physical office required?
No, virtual offices are accepted for many business types.
3. How long does setup take?
Typically 2β5 working days for registration.
4. Is Bahrain tax-free?
Yes, except for VAT on certain goods/services.
5. Can I open a bank account remotely?
In most cases, some physical verification may still be required.
